5. Diablo III
Such was the spectacle of Diablo III's disastrous launch that it completely overshadowed the massive development time of the game. The awful DRM/always online debacle really helped people forget this game took eleven years to come out.
Though for the unknowing, the existence of the game only came to light in 2008. It had actually been in development seven years prior, before Blizzard North was amalgamated with the main company.
Part of the delay was the game's switch to Blizzard's own proprietary engine, instead of the Havok engine used in previous installments. However, it was 2008's announcement that touted the much-derided always online nonsense, much to everyone's chagrin.
Fortunately, massive piracy nonsense aside, Diablo III was a commercial and critical success. As someone who has dabbled with the series, it was worth the wait.
